Conclusion
Shimano Torium 14HGA / Right handX clearly outshines Shimano Catana 2500 RC, offering significantly better performance in durability (8.52 out of 10) and maximum drag (15kg / 33,07lbs). While Shimano Catana 2500 RC may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Shimano Torium 14HGA / Right handX is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
